Wann, OK Demographics
A map of Wann's Population by Race
Wann, Oklahoma has an estimated population of 87, a decrease from the 95 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 72.4% White, 16.1% Multiracial, 5.7% Hispanic, 5.7% Native American/Other, 0.0% Black, and 0.0% Asian. Wann has become more rac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than Oklahoma over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Wann, that probability was 43.3% in 2020 and 44.3% in the most recent ACS estimates.
Wann is ranked the 694th most populous place in Oklahoma, out of 846 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Wann was ranked the 681st most populous place in the 2020 Census.
Wann's White Population
63 residents of Wann, or 72.4% of the population, identify as White. The share of White residents in Wann is considerably higher than in Oklahoma overall, where 62.1% of the population is White. Wann ranks 263rd statewide in terms of White residents as a share of the population, out of 846 places.
Since the 2020 Census, Wann's White population has declined by an estimated 10.0%. White residents' share of Wann's population has decreased from 73.7% to 72.4%.
Wann is more White than neighboring Dewey (59.7% White). Wann is less White than neighboring Copan (75.3% White), Tyro (80.2% White), Caney (80.4% White), and Dearing (84.9% White).
